What would happen to a persons energy levels if the septum had a hole in it? Why?

1 Answer

6 votes
A large atrial septal defect can cause extra blood to overfill the lungs and overwork the right side of the heart. If not treated, the right side of the heart eventually enlarges and weakens. The blood pressure in your lungs can also increase, leading to pulmonary hypertension
